I've actually been meaning to get into the CoD games, as I've heard some of them actually have good single-player campaigns (I don't give two fucks for multiplayer)--but the shear number of these things make it pretty difficult to even know what one is supposed to be good and what one is a multiplayer expansion priced at $60.


Go with Call of Duty 4: Modern Warfare (Best of the series, really), Call of Duty: Black Ops, and Call of Duty: Black Ops 2 if you're just after a good campaign. The Russian front in World at War is pretty good, but the Japanese levels are just horrid. Modern Warfare 2 and Modern Warfare 3's campaigns are kind of weak, and have weak attempts at "shocking" moments, but they're the game equivalent of a standard action movie - a fun roller-coaster ride and little else.

Don't let the bawwing get you down. You might be better off just renting the games if you're not bothering with the multiplayer, but otherwise, you should be set.
